What legal steps must a union take before organising industrial action in the UK?

Before organising industrial action, unions must follow key legal steps, including conducting a lawful ballot, notifying the employer of the ballot, securing majority support, and providing 14 days’ notice of the action. Failure to comply can lead to legal challenges or dismissal risks for members. We ensure all steps are followed to protect your union.

What is the balloting process for industrial action, and how can we avoid legal challenges?

The balloting process requires secret voting by affected members, with clear information on the dispute and action. The employer must be notified of the results and intended action. Errors in this process may lead to legal challenges. Anthony Gold Solicitors ensure your ballot meets all legal requirements, reducing the risk of disputes.

What are the risks if an employer challenges our industrial action with an injunction?

An employer can seek an injunction to halt industrial action, usually due to procedural errors or non-compliance with legal requirements. If successful, this could stop the action and lead to further costs. We have extensive experience defending unions against injunctions to keep your action on track.

What happens if our union makes an error during the notice process for industrial action?

Errors in the notice process can result in an employer challenging the action or seeking an injunction. This could halt the action and expose the union to damages. Anthony Gold Solicitors ensure your notice process complies with the law, minimising the risk of legal issues and safeguarding your members.
